Ernest PIGNON-ERNEST,

a niçois artist

Biographie

Ernest Pignon-Ernest was born in Nice in 1942 he is French. He is an artist : one of the pioneers of street art. He actually lives in Paris (the french capital) and he is a Defensor of Humans Rights.  He studied in Nice (architecture).

In 1974 he reacted to the twinning of le Cap in South Africa and Nice. He did a series « jumelage Nice the le corp ». He took an engagement against apartheid. He sticked more than 1000 drawings on the walls in Nice with the help of his friend. He did silk-screen paintings. He was inspirated by poets, his art is ephemeral : the street is the settings and the subject of his ephemeral works of art. He shows a total engagement in political, poetic, and plastic. The aim of his art is to open the eyes of the spectator to look at misery, poverty, immigration, racism and epidemics.

He is the witness of his time.

A quotation of the artist : « Places are my essential materials.I try to understand, to grasp everything that can be seen there-space, light, colours-and at the same time everything that cannot or no longer be seen: history, buried memories. »
